Deeper Sounds of Nairobi and Caffé Mocha are a series of radio podcasts and shows recorded and produced in different parts of the World. They are geared toward showcasing African House/Dance music that's stirring up the Global Airwaves and Dancefloors,compiled and mixed by Jack Rooster for your listening pleasure.© Jack Rooster.     We’re beyond excited to welcome back an old friend and absolute legend on the decks: DJ B-Town, flying in all the way from Canada! This mix is a musical diary to the start of his 2026 year — blending the cozy, quiet introspections of winter in Downtown Toronto with the vibrant energy of a lakeside summer. But the real magic comes from his travels to Durban, where he soaked up the rhythmic pulse and incredible warmth of the Amapiano / Afro House / Deep House / Afro Tech scene. The result? A soulful bridge between snowy Canadian streets and the heartbeat of South Africa.     Fresh off my latest live performance in Venice during the just‑concluded Venice Carnival 3 day Festival, where over 3,000 beautiful souls came together for a magical weekend of rhythm, color, and global unity - I’m excited to share a sonic journey inspired directly by that electrifying night.This episode captures the same energy that lit up the dancefloor: deep, percussive, Afro‑electronic textures, blended with soulful grooves and modern Nairobi vibes. The selection leans into atmospheric builds, hypnotic baselines, and culturally rich rhythms - all crafted to transport you right back to that unforgettable weekend.At the heart of this mix are standout Kenyan tracks that carried the crowd into a frenzy during the show. Watendawili’s “Tumia Pesa” sets the tone early with its unmistakable Kenyan bounce, grounding the entire journey in homegrown rhythm. Savara’s “Forever (JackRooster SpedUp Version)” injects that signature Nairobi fire, while Xenia Manasseh’s “Cheza Chini (Kevin servHis RMX)” adds a lush, soulful depth that resonated beautifully with the international audience.These records - proudly Kenyan and globally appealing - became the emotional anchors of the night, drawing cheers, whistles, and hands in the air from a crowd that felt the pulse of Nairobi even thousands of miles away.Complementing these highlights is a selection of exclusive Jack Rooster AfroGroove Edits - festival‑tested, rhythm‑driven cuts sculpted specifically for high‑energy dancefloors.
